source from: pexels
引言:FlashFXP上传设置生效之谜
在网站管理过程中,FlashFXP上传设置扮演着至关重要的角色。然而,许多用户往往忽视了一个问题:修改上传设置后,何时生效?事实上,这个问题并非小事,因为它直接关系到网站更新和维护的效率。令人费解的是,修改后的设置生效时间竟然存在不确定性,这不禁让人好奇背后的原因。本文将深入探讨FlashFXP上传设置生效时间之谜,帮助您更好地理解这一现象,提高网站管理效率。
一、FlashFXP上传设置基础
1、FlashFXP简介及其上传功能
FlashFXP是一款功能强大的FTP(文件传输协议)客户端软件,广泛用于网站管理员和开发者进行文件的上传和下载。它具备高效、稳定的特点,能够帮助用户快速完成网站内容的更新和维护。
FlashFXP的核心功能之一是上传设置,通过调整这些设置,用户可以优化上传速度、保证上传的安全性以及满足特定的上传需求。
2、常见的上传设置选项
FlashFXP的上传设置包括以下几个方面:
- 传输模式:选择适合的传输模式,如PASV或PORT,可以提高上传速度。
- 连接速度限制:设置连接速度限制,可以避免上传过程中占用过多带宽。
- 文件传输类型:选择文件传输类型,如ASCII或BINARY,确保文件传输的准确性。
- 断点续传:开启断点续传功能,可以确保上传过程中出现断线后,能够从上次中断的地方继续上传。
- 自动重连:设置自动重连,可以保证上传过程中出现连接中断时,能够自动重新连接。
以上这些上传设置选项,用户可以根据自己的实际需求进行选择和调整。
二、修改上传设置后的生效机制
1、即时生效的情况
在大多数情况下,修改FlashFXP的上传设置后,可以立即生效。这通常发生在以下几种情况:
- 设置更改不涉及服务器端操作:例如,更改本地文件夹路径、文件类型过滤等,这些操作仅影响客户端,不会影响服务器端。
- 服务器端配置允许即时生效:一些服务器配置允许客户端设置更改后立即生效,无需重启FTP服务。
2、需要重启FTP服务的情况
在某些情况下,修改上传设置后需要重启FTP服务才能生效。这通常发生在以下几种情况:
- 涉及服务器端配置的更改:例如,更改FTP服务器的根目录、端口等。
- 更改了FTP服务器的安全设置:例如,更改用户权限、密码等。
3、缓存更新对生效时间的影响
FTP服务器通常会缓存客户端的设置,以便快速响应后续请求。当修改设置后,服务器可能需要一段时间来更新缓存,这可能会延迟设置生效的时间。以下是一些可能影响缓存更新的因素:
- 缓存大小:较大的缓存可能需要更长时间来更新。
- 服务器负载:服务器负载较高时,缓存更新可能需要更长的时间。
- 缓存策略:不同的缓存策略可能会导致不同的更新时间。
缓存更新因素 | 影响程度 |
---|---|
缓存大小 | 较大缓存可能需要更长时间更新 |
服务器负载 | 服务器负载较高时,缓存更新可能需要更长的时间 |
缓存策略 | 不同的缓存策略可能会导致不同的更新时间 |
三、影响生效时间的因素分析
1、服务器配置的影响
服务器配置是影响FlashFXP上传设置生效时间的关键因素之一。不同的服务器配置可能导致设置生效的时间有所不同。例如,某些服务器可能配置了较为严格的权限控制,使得修改上传设置后需要重启FTP服务才能生效。以下是几种常见的服务器配置因素:
配置因素 | 说明 | 影响生效时间 |
---|---|---|
FTP服务权限 | 服务器的FTP服务权限设置较为严格时,可能需要重启FTP服务才能使修改生效。 | 可能需要等待重启FTP服务后生效 |
服务器性能 | 服务器性能较低时,可能需要较长时间才能更新缓存,导致设置生效时间延长。 | 可能需要等待服务器性能提升后生效 |
操作系统 | 不同的操作系统对FTP服务的支持程度不同,可能导致设置生效时间有所差异。 | 可能因操作系统差异而影响生效时间 |
2、FTP服务器的缓存机制
FTP服务器通常都会设置缓存机制,以加速文件传输速度。当修改FlashFXP上传设置时,服务器会先读取缓存中的数据,如果缓存中数据与修改后的设置一致,则不会重新加载缓存。以下是一些影响缓存机制的因素:
缓存机制因素 | 说明 | 影响生效时间 |
---|---|---|
缓存大小 | 缓存大小越大,更新缓存所需时间越长。 | 可能需要较长时间更新缓存 |
缓存更新频率 | 缓存更新频率越高,修改后的设置越快生效。 | 更新频率越高,生效时间越短 |
缓存数据一致性 | 缓存数据与实际设置的一致性越高,生效时间越短。 | 一致性越高,生效时间越短 |
3、网络环境的影响
网络环境也是影响FlashFXP上传设置生效时间的重要因素。以下是一些网络环境因素:
网络环境因素 | 说明 | 影响生效时间 |
---|---|---|
带宽 | 网络带宽越高,数据传输速度越快,生效时间越短。 | 带宽越高,生效时间越短 |
网络延迟 | 网络延迟越低,数据传输速度越快,生效时间越短。 | 网络延迟越低,生效时间越短 |
网络稳定性 | 网络稳定性越高,生效时间越短。 | 网络稳定性越高,生效时间越短 |
四、如何确认设置已生效
1. 检查服务器日志
服务器日志是确认FlashFXP上传设置是否生效的重要手段。在服务器管理员的协助下,你可以查看日志中是否有相应的上传操作记录。通常,这些记录会显示文件的上传时间和上传结果,从而帮助你确认设置是否已经正确应用。
步骤 | 描述 |
---|---|
1 | 请求管理员获取服务器日志文件路径。 |
2 | 打开日志文件,搜索上传操作相关的记录。 |
3 | 对比上传时间和操作前的设置,确认设置是否生效。 |
2. 进行上传测试
上传测试是确认设置生效的另一种方法。在完成设置修改后,你可以尝试上传一个小文件到服务器上。如果上传成功,并且上传的文件属性与预期一致,则可以判断设置已生效。
步骤 | 描述 |
---|---|
1 | 在本地创建一个测试文件,如1KB大小的文本文件。 |
2 | 将文件通过FlashFXP上传到服务器。 |
3 | 检查服务器上的文件是否正确上传,且属性与本地文件一致。 |
3. 联系服务器管理员确认
如果以上两种方法都无法确认设置是否生效,你可以直接联系服务器管理员寻求帮助。管理员可以根据经验判断设置是否正确,并提供进一步的解决方案。
步骤 | 描述 |
---|---|
1 | 通过邮件或电话联系服务器管理员。 |
2 | 提供你的设置截图或详细描述,方便管理员进行排查。 |
3 | 等待管理员回复,并根据建议进行调整。 |
结语:高效管理FlashFXP上传设置
在深入了解FlashFXP上传设置及其生效机制后,我们可以更高效地管理上传过程,提高工作效率。理解设置生效时间的重要性,可以帮助我们在遇到问题时迅速定位并解决,避免不必要的等待和困扰。以下是一些建议,帮助您在实际操作中灵活应用:
- 熟悉基础设置:定期回顾FlashFXP的基础设置,确保各项参数符合您的需求。
- 及时更新:当服务器或网络环境发生变化时,及时更新上传设置,以适应新的环境。
- 记录日志:养成检查服务器日志的习惯,有助于快速发现并解决问题。
- 测试上传:在更改设置后,进行上传测试,以确保设置生效。
- 咨询管理员:如果遇到无法解决的问题,及时联系服务器管理员寻求帮助。
通过掌握这些技巧,您可以更加高效地使用FlashFXP,提高上传效率,确保网站内容的及时更新。记住,灵活应用和实践是掌握任何工具的关键。不断学习和实践,您将成为FlashFXP的高手!
常见问题
1、修改设置后立即生效吗?
修改FlashFXP上传设置后,是否立即生效取决于服务器配置和缓存机制。在大多数情况下,设置修改后会立即生效。然而,在某些服务器上,可能需要重启FTP服务或等待缓存更新后,设置才会生效。
2、为什么我的设置修改后没有立即生效?
如果修改设置后没有立即生效,可能是因为以下几个原因:
- 服务器配置问题:服务器配置可能不支持即时生效的设置修改。
- FTP服务缓存机制:FTP服务器的缓存机制可能导致设置修改后需要等待缓存更新。
- 网络环境问题:网络环境不稳定也可能影响设置修改的生效时间。
3、如何重启FTP服务?
重启FTP服务的具体方法取决于服务器操作系统和FTP服务软件。以下是一些常见操作:
- Linux系统:在终端输入
service vsftpd restart
(以vsftpd为例)。 - Windows系统:找到FTP服务管理器,选择“重启”操作。
- Mac系统:在“系统偏好设置”中找到“共享”,选择“FTP服务器”,点击“重启”。
4、服务器日志在哪里查看?
服务器日志通常存储在服务器的特定目录下。以下是一些常见服务器日志路径:
- Apache服务器:
/var/log/apache2/access.log
和/var/log/apache2/error.log
- Nginx服务器:
/var/log/nginx/access.log
和/var/log/nginx/error.log
- MySQL服务器:
/var/log/mysqld.log
5、上传测试失败怎么办?
如果上传测试失败,可以尝试以下方法:
- 检查网络连接:确保网络连接稳定,没有丢包现象。
- 检查文件权限:确保上传文件的权限允许被服务器访问。
- 检查服务器配置:检查服务器配置是否正确,是否存在限制上传功能的相关设置。
- 联系服务器管理员:如果以上方法无法解决问题,请联系服务器管理员寻求帮助。
原创文章,作者:路飞SEO,如若转载,请注明出处:https://www.shuziqianzhan.com/article/60665.html